USU Drops Mountain West Opener In Road Loss To Air Force

SALT LAKE CITY – The Utah State men’s basketball team began Mountain West Conference play with a close loss on the road to the Air Force Falcons.

The Falcons hosted the Aggies on Wednesday, December 29.

USU fell to Air Force, 49-47.

It was a back-and-forth contest all game long. Following the opening 20 minutes of action, the Aggies and Falcons went to the halftime break knotted at 22 apiece.

The teams were neck-and-neck down to the closing minutes of the game until the battle was decided at the free throw line.

USU struggled to score during the last few minutes.

After a Justin Bean dunk cut Utah State’s deficit to one point, the Aggies failed to score in the final three minutes until Steven Ashworth buried a couple of free throws with five seconds remaining.

Ashworth’s potential game-tying three-point attempt didn’t connect with one second to go and the Aggies fell by two points.

Neither team owned a lead of more than seven points throughout the game.

Utah State finished the game shooting 32.7 percent overall and only 1-19 for 5.3 percent from beyond the arc. Bean led USU with 18 points and 10 rebounds.

Air Force shot 36.0 percent from the field, including 29.6 percent from downtown.

With the loss, the Aggies fell to 9-5 on the season, including an 0-1 record in conference action.

Utah State’s next game is at home against the Boise State Broncos on Tuesday, January 4, 2022, at 8 p.m. (MDT).
